Liverpool will hand a cut of their Luis Suarez fee to Ajax.
The Mirror says Liverpool will hand Ajax a £2million windfall as part of the £75m deal that has taken Luis Suarez to Barcelona.
The Dutch champions insisted on a sell-on clause when they sold the Uruguay striker to the Reds for £22.8m in January 2011.
Liverpool's American owner John W Henry had the foresight to cap the payment at £2m rather than offering a percentage of any future transfer - and that has saved the club millions after Suarez became the world's third most expensive footballer after Gareth Bale and Cristiano Ronaldo.
